My issue is with the EQ1 portion of WinEQ2.

The preferences to which I refer are found by right-clicking the WinEQ2 icon, options tab, & clicking preferences. The preferences menu appears. Click the EverQuest tab, click the sub-tab labeled Hotkeys.

There seems to be a change in the "Key Name List" portion of the "hotkeys" tab. You can now only set "L button" "R button" "X button 1" "X button2" & "M button" as possible hotkeys. These seem like buttons on a controller one would plug into a USB port or something similar. I attempted to set those letters on the keyboard as hotkeys to no avail. I also attempted to set different keys to hotkeys in the .ini file also to no avail. In fact, the program has even deleted the "ctrl" & "alt" out of the global hotkeys section because those are not "valid" keys either. I do not own nor have installed any controllers. So, WinEQ would not be picking up any indication that I ever used a controller instead of a keyboard.

I have no window hotkeys & am having to use the mouse to switch between windows. This causes my chat window to get a cursor in it & I cannot get in game "hot button" commands to work until I enter out the cursor in the chat window.
